Ghost Lines Project

"Ghost lines" is a movement practice that uses an archival impulse to conjure a vaudevillian past.

As a project, it manifests in a variety of ways – through film, live art happenings, live performance, as photos, drawings, and an ongoing freestyle movement practice.
